31 And they thought with themselves, saying, If we shall say, From heaven, he will say, Why then did ye not believe him?

32 [a]But if we say, Of men, we fear the people: for all men counted John that he was a Prophet indeed.

33 Then they answered, and said unto Jesus, We cannot tell. And Jesus answered, and said unto them, Neither will I tell you by what authority I do these things.
